Position Overview:
This position purchases and manages securitized and individual federally
guaranteed loan investments to create value for the organization and
seeks to achieve the company\'s portfolio diversification objectives.
Essential Functions:
- Searches for potential investments and gathers necessary information
for determining acceptability.
- Prepares, analyzes and summarizes investment models to determine
eligibility, feasibility, prepayment risk, and economic returns of
investment options.
- Evaluates investment offerings, ensures fit with diversification and
performance objectives, makes and executes investment decisions.
- Develops and maintains external relationships for the purpose of
developing new business.
- Services, re-prices, and manages existing loan portfolio through
lead lenders, brokers, and federal agencies.
- Monitors market trends and applies knowledge to investment decision
strategy.
- Generates acceptable return for risk and achieves satisfactory
administration of the investment portfolio.
